Output de32783180d85eea69360a144c812a124d7a7c0f0fc0f12e60d893f77856145a:2

value
264887279
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dead354c78f633aabeaf50da71980e54a0453c96 OP_EQUALVERIFY OP_CHECKSIG
address
LfXMmWsvfjtuwHV8twxuJt4FLSETWQcLqH
transaction
de32783180d85eea69360a144c812a124d7a7c0f0fc0f12e60d893f77856145a
spent
true